Jerry bought 4 times as many pencils as notebooks and spent a total of $21.60. He spent $2.40 more on the notebooks than pencils. Given that a notebook costs $3.20 more than a pencil, find the cost of a pencil.

Let the cost of a pencil be $x
So, the cost of a notebook = $(x + 3.20)
If Jerry bought y notebooks, then he bought 4y pencils.
He spent $x * 4y = $4xy on pencils
He spent $(x + 3.20) * y = $(xy + 3.20y) on notebooks.
Now, xy + 3.20y - 4xy = 2.40
3.20y - 3xy = 2.40
3.20y = 3xy + 2.40
Also, 4xy + xy + 3.20y = 21.60
5xy + 3.20y = 21.60
5xy + 3xy + 2.40 = 21.60
8xy = 21.60 - 2.40
8xy = 19.20
xy = 19.20/8
xy = 2.40
So, 3.20y = 3xy + 2.40 = 3* 2.40 + 2.40 = 9.60
y = 9.60/3.20 = 3
So, x = 2.40/y = 2.40/3 = 0.80
The cost of a pencil is $0.80
